Job Summary:
We are looking for a skilled Front-End Developer to join our dynamic team in Saudi Arabia. The ideal candidate will be responsible for translating UI/UX designs into functional and visually appealing web interfaces, ensuring a seamless user experience across all devices and platforms.
Key Responsibilities:
-
Develop responsive and interactive web interfaces using HTML5, CSS3, JavaScript, and modern frameworks (e.g., React, Vue.js, or Angular).
-
Collaborate with designers and back-end developers to deliver user-friendly solutions.
-
Optimize applications for maximum speed, scalability, and performance.
-
Ensure cross-browser and cross-platform compatibility.
-
Maintain and improve existing website codebases.
-
Implement best practices for SEO and accessibility.
-
Participate in code reviews and stay updated with the latest front-end trends and technologies.
Qualifications & Requirements:
-
Bachelor’s degree in Computer Science, Software Engineering, or a related field.
-
2–5 years of proven experience as a Front-End Developer.
-
Strong knowledge of HTML, CSS, JavaScript, and front-end frameworks (React, Angular, or Vue).
-
Experience with RESTful APIs, Git version control, and responsive design.
-
Understanding of UI/UX principles and cross-browser compatibility.
-
Basic knowledge of back-end technologies (Node.js, PHP, or similar) is a plus.
-
Strong problem-solving skills and attention to detail.
Preferred Skills:
-
Familiarity with TypeScript, Next.js, or Tailwind CSS.
-
Experience working in Agile/Scrum environments.
-
Knowledge of Figma, Adobe XD, or similar design tools.
-
Fluent in English (Arabic is a plus).